What is Founder-Market Fit?
Founder-Market Fit
It refers to the alignment between a founder's skills, experiences, and passions with the market they are targeting. When a founder understands their market deeply and can leverage their unique insights, they are more likely to succeed in building a business.
Overview
Founder-Market Fit is a concept in entrepreneurship that describes how well a founder's background and expertise align with the market they are trying to serve. This fit is crucial because when founders have a deep understanding of their market, they can identify opportunities, solve real problems, and create products that resonate with customers. For example, a founder who has worked in the fitness industry may have insights that help them create a successful health app, as they understand the needs and challenges of their target audience. The idea is that a founder's unique experiences can lead to innovative solutions that others might overlook. When a founder is passionate about their market, they are more likely to persist through challenges and adapt their business model as needed. This persistence can be a key factor in a startup's success, as the journey of building a business is often filled with obstacles that require resilience and creativity. Moreover, Founder-Market Fit helps in attracting investors and building a strong team. Investors are more likely to back a founder who has a clear vision and a strong connection to their market. Similarly, a founder who understands the market can attract team members who share the same passion and commitment, creating a cohesive and motivated group working towards a common goal.
